Output 84f38484eb07a3b5641480fd121e27803c68735088aed71f6183f70410766bf7:0

value
103336000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b1cfdbf5ffda193742aaf19ad791b059e8bfe84 OP_EQUAL
address
MEkKeAKPmzfgjcJbjh8vCWeiKMiTVKMRzX
transaction
84f38484eb07a3b5641480fd121e27803c68735088aed71f6183f70410766bf7
spent
true